How much do drivers temp j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 9, 2026, the average hourly pay for drivers temp in the United States is $18.75,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$14.42 and $20.19 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are some common challenges faced by drivers temp and how can they be managed?

Drivers Temp often encounter challenges such as navigating unfamiliar routes, adapting to different vehicle types, and managing tight delivery schedules. Flexibility and strong communication skills are essential, as assignments and work environments may change frequently. To succeed, it's helpful to familiarize yourself with navigation apps, maintain open lines of communication with dispatchers, and remain organized to handle changing priorities efficiently.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a drivers temp,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Drivers Temp, you need a valid driver’s license, a clean driving record, and a solid understanding of road safety regulations. Familiarity with GPS navigation systems, route planning software, and sometimes specialized vehicle operation certifications are commonly required. Reliability, strong communication, and time management are vital soft skills for handling schedules and interacting with clients or dispatchers. These skills ensure safe, efficient, and dependable transportation services, which are critical to customer satisfaction and operational success.

What is a drivers temp?

Drivers Temp, or temporary drivers, are professionals hired on a short-term basis to transport goods, materials, or passengers. They often work through staffing agencies or directly with companies to fill in during busy periods, staff shortages, or special projects. Temporary drivers may operate various vehicles, including delivery vans, trucks, or passenger cars, depending on the employer's needs. This role requires a valid driver's license, a clean driving record, and sometimes specific certifications depending on the type of vehicle. Temporary driving jobs can be a flexible option for those seeking short-term or seasonal work.
